Gomes da Silva is a leading authority in control systems and mobile robotics, with a particular focus on the application of Model Predictive Control (MPC) to autonomous navigation. His seminal 2005 work, "Mobile Robot Trajectory Tracking Using Model Predictive Control," which has garnered 118 citations, stands as a cornerstone in the field. In this research, he masterfully addressed the complex trajectory tracking problem for nonholonomic wheeled mobile robots (WMRs), demonstrating how MPC’s inherent ability to handle control and state constraints could be leveraged for precise and robust path following. This contribution was pivotal, moving beyond traditional control methods to provide a more practical and constraint-aware framework for real-world robotic applications. By systematically integrating MPC with the kinematic constraints of WMRs, Gomes da Silva provided a foundational solution that has influenced subsequent work in autonomous vehicles and mobile manipulation.
